What you need:
Dye cap,
A hook needle thingy to pull the hair through (think you can get it in the same isle as the cap if not go borrow your grans crochet needle)
Dye ( I used Reflections Highlighting set I do recommend that you don't use it  the Reflection rage over all doesn't really work)

Sorry forgot to take a before photo.

 Step one: part hair as you normally do, put cap on and pull hair through.
NOTE your hair need to be damp before pulling through depending on what you use, just do as the dye packet instructions say.









Step two: mix the dye, and feel like a scientist (Try not tho inhale keep doors open and windows if you can) stir till all the lumps are out




 Step three : apply thoroughly on hair that is pulled through. Depending on what the instructions says wait that time. I had to wait 10m but left it on longer
